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2007.05.06;
Скачать: CL | DM;

Вниз

Oracle8 - cLOB   Найти похожие ветки 

 
Gentos   (2007-04-17 11:55) [0]

Уважаемые мастера. У меня есть табличка

TABLE  tbl
(
 ID   NUMBER        NOT NULL,
 JPG  CLOB
)

Я занес туда 2 фотки.

insert into tbl values (1,"D:\pictures\fotka.jpg");
insert into tbl values (2,"D:\pictures\fotkaa.jpg");

Как мне теперь можна через делфи достать эти фотки из этой таблицы и показать.
Написал что-то такое, знае что надо использовать TLobLocator

procedure TForm1.Button1Click(Sender: TObject);
var
 LOB: TLobLocator;
begin
    LobCreateTemporary(LOB);
end;

procedure TForm1.LobCreateTemporary(var LOB: TLobLocator);
begin
 LOB := TLOBLocator.Create(OS,otCLOB);
 EMPTY_CLOB.SetComplexVariable("TEMP_LOB", LOB);
 EMPTY_CLOB.Execute;
end;

в EMPTY_CLOB.sql написал

BEGIN
 DBMS_LOB.CREATETEMPORARY(:TEMP_LOB,FALSE);
END;

Как можно вытащить эти фотки с моей таблицы ?


 
Reindeer Moss Eater ©   (2007-04-17 11:58) [1]

Как можно вытащить эти фотки с моей таблицы ?

А они там есть?


 
Gentos   (2007-04-17 12:01) [2]

ну если вы такое написали, значит нет, а как их туда ... мда , сколько всего еще надо узнать


 
Reindeer Moss Eater ©   (2007-04-17 12:02) [3]

Для начала полезно выяснить какие данные можно хранить в CLOB полях и что означает первая буква в имени типа CLOB.


 
Desdechado ©   (2007-04-17 12:06) [4]

Козырнее всего хранить картинки в виде набора записей, в каждой из которых - 1 байт картинки
:))



Страницы: 1 вся ветка

Текущий архив: 2007.05.06;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.031 c
15-1175927960
ArMellon
2007-04-07 10:39
2007.05.06
Как экспортировать ветку рееста в файл и обратно импортировать


15-1176156862
muh2
2007-04-10 02:14
2007.05.06
Trackbar


2-1176796245
allucard
2007-04-17 11:50
2007.05.06
Чтение файла


15-1175969605
cyborg
2007-04-07 22:13
2007.05.06
Однако!


4-1165566420
yaJohn
2006-12-08 11:27
2007.05.06
Системное контекстное меню